Classes | |
| class | BatchAllocator |
| class | CustomWriter |
| Writes a Value in JSON format with custom formatting. | |
| class | FastWriter |
| Outputs a Value in JSON format without formatting (not human friendly). | |
| class | Features |
| Configuration passed to reader and writer. This configuration object can be used to force the Reader or Writer to behave in a standard conforming way. | |
| class | Path |
| Experimental and untested: represents a "path" to access a node. | |
| class | PathArgument |
| Experimental and untested: represents an element of the "path" to access a node. | |
| class | Reader |
| Unserialize a JSON document into a Value. | |
| class | StaticString |
| Lightweight wrapper to tag static string. | |
| class | StyledStreamWriter |
| Writes a Value in JSON format in a human friendly way, to a stream rather than to a string. | |
| class | StyledWriter |
| Writes a Value in JSON format in a human friendly way. | |
| class | Value |
| Represents a JSON value. | |
| class | ValueConstIterator |
| const iterator for object and array value. | |
| class | ValueIterator |
| Iterator for object and array value. | |
| class | ValueIteratorBase |
| base class for Value iterators. | |
| class | Writer |
| Abstract class for writers. | |

| std::istream & Json::operator>> | ( | std::istream & | sin, |
| Value & | root | ||
| ) |
Read from 'sin' into 'root'.
Always keep comments from the input JSON.
This can be used to read a file into a particular sub-object. For example:
Result:
{
"dir": {
"file": {
// The input stream JSON would be nested here.
}
}
}
| std::exception | on parse error. |
